TICKET: SpoolHawk config drift — prod-east

SpoolHawk (printer-spooler microservice) on prod-east is running values that don't match the baseline in the Fernwick deploy repo. Retry intervals and queue caps were hand-edited during the Larkspur incident and never reverted. Jobs are draining slower than staging by roughly 40%. Do not restart until values are reconciled; a restart will reload the drifted file. Compare against the baseline before touching anything. Current live values for the node follow below.

config for yajep-tafof:
[rusath]
team = julmir
access_code = ac_fe37fd
host = rusath.novactech.test
port = 8000
owner = pelmir.weneth
peer = oliwyn.olvarqdyn.internal

So, the nightly reconciliation jobs on Quillhaven were firing up to eleven minutes late, which is why the ledger snapshots looked stale to downstream consumers. Turns out the scheduler node's clock sync service was silently failing after a kernel update, and drift accumulated between restarts. We've pinned the sync daemon, added an alert when skew exceeds two seconds, and backfilled the affected snapshots. Nothing malicious found, but worth a second look from security given the timing gaps. The investigation lead is listed below.

approver of yawig-yajef = Briius Jorix

Handover note — Crumbwheel order cutoffs.

Welcome aboard. The bakery cutoff rule in Crumbwheel closes same-day orders at 14:00 local to each storefront, not UTC — this has bitten us twice. Holiday overrides live in the calendar service and take precedence silently, so always check there first when a cutoff looks wrong. To unlock the calendar service's admin console after a restart, enter the recovery passphrase below.

vault phrase of bagap-bahaf = silion-pelox-sorox-casdor-quenwyn-fraax-eliox-praael-kelion-quenvan-kasox-rusael-norius-belvan

Leadership Review Briefing — Closure of the Hale Crossing Office

For branch managers: the Hale Crossing office will close at quarter-end following the consolidation review. Its seven staff move to the Bremmott hub; client files transfer next month. Lease exit costs are within budget. Signage and mail redirection are handled centrally. The confidential note on related business plans is appended immediately below.

internal memo for kawip-hadug: Headcount on the Wenwyn team goes from 7 to 140 by the end of January. Gross margin on Wenwyn came in at 20 percent against a plan of 15 percent.